Our Program:
BRHS offers a single program providing the opportunity to consolidate practice in various areas in the clinical settings, including a potential primary health care rotation to our East Gippsland partner Gippsland Lakes Complete Health (GLCH) in Lakes Entrance.
- 12 month program commencing January 2026
- Permanent appointment (subject to performance)
- Ongoing, 0.6 - 1.0 EFT by negotiation
- 2 x 6 month rotational positions throughout the hospital
- Rotations are available in; Medical/Surgical TAMBO ward, Medical/Palliative/Paediatrics Rotamah ward, and Rehabilitation/ AOD Flanagan ward. Specialty rotations are available in; Emergency, Perioperative areas and Midwifery (dual degree graduates only), with the opportunity to indicate your preference. Off-site primary health care rotation also available

How to Apply:
All applicants must ensure they complete the 2-step process:
- Apply to PMCV (https://gnmp.pmcv.com.au) using the applicant portal
- Apply directly to Bairnsdale Regional Health Service
BRHS application to include:
- Responses to key selection criteria listed in the position description
- A resume (with photo attached)
- Certified Academic Transcript
- Certified copies of your last 2 clinical appraisals (1 must be from 3rd year)
- Name and contact details of 2 clinical references that must be a clinical supervisor from a student placement such as Nurse unit manager, Clinical nurse consultant, clinical nurse educator or clinical facilitator
